How to generate an image from a text prompt

Text-to-image is the starting point for most of what else on this site does — an image you generate here can be upscaled, edited, animated into video, or used as the reference for a talking avatar. Getting the prompt right the first time is less about clever wording than about being specific.

Step by step

  1. 1

    Describe the subject, setting and style together

    A single sentence with all three does better than a vague noun. 'A red apple on a wooden table, studio lighting' outperforms 'an apple'.

  2. 2

    Pick a model

    The default suits most prompts. Try a different one if a particular style — photoreal, illustrative — matters more than usual.

  3. 3

    Generate a few at once

    Up to four variations in one request, each billed as one image. Comparing variations side by side is faster than iterating on one.

What if the result does not match what I asked for?

Rewrite the prompt to be more specific rather than adding more adjectives. Naming the subject, setting and style explicitly works better than qualifying words like 'beautiful' or 'amazing'.
